WHAT IS CHIPOTLE RANCH MADE OF?

The base of Chipotle Ranch Dressing is made up of mayonnaise, greek yogurt, and buttermilk. If you don't have greek yogurt, you can use sour cream. If you don't have buttermilk, use whole milk, along with a teaspoon of vinegar (white, rice wine, or distilled vinegar will work just fine). 

It is seasoned with the same dried herbs and spices you would typically find in any ranch dressing recipe: salt, pepper, garlic powder, onion powder, and dill. What sets this recipe apart from a typical ranch dressing are the chipotle peppers.

In addition to the chipotle peppers, a squeeze of fresh lime and a little cilantro add a nice and zesty touch, rounding out the dressing perfectly.

WHAT ARE CHIPOTLE PEPPERS?

Chipotles are dried smoked jalapeños, but Chipotles in Adobo are dried, smoked jalapeños that come fully drenched in Adobo Sauce. The spice is not overwhelming, but if you are sensitive to spicy foods, consider steering clear of them.

Adobo Sauce is made up mostly of ingredients like chili powder, tomatoes, vinegar, garlic, peppercorns, cumin…and the list goes on. It’s for this reason, we’re grateful for the ever-so convenient Chipotles in Adobo.

CAN I TURN THIS DRESSING INTO A DIP?

If you're looking to turn Chipotle Ranch Dressing into a dip, simply leave the buttermilk out of the recipe and add the same amount of greek yogurt (or sour cream) in its place.

This will thicken it up, making it perfect for snacking on with either vegetables or chips!

Chipotle Ranch Dressing

5-Minute Chipotle Ranch Dressing is easy to make in the blender! It's smoky, tangy, and extra delicious thanks to zesty chipotles, lime, and cilantro!
Prep Time5 minutes mins
Total Time5 minutes mins
Course: Condiment, Salad Dressing
Cuisine: American, Mexican, Tex-Mex
Keyword: Chipotle Ranch Dressing
Servings: 6
Calories: 141kcal
Author: Kelly Anthony

Ingredients

  • ½ cup mayonnaise
  • ¼ cup greek yogurt (or sour cream)
  • ¼ cup buttermilk
  • 1 tablespoon fresh-squeezed lime juice
  • 2 tablespoons cilantro leaves
  • ½ teaspoon Kosher salt
  • ½ teaspoon garlic powder
  • ¼ teaspoon onion powder
  • ½ teaspoon dried dill
  • 1 chipotle pepper (from a can of chipotles in adobo sauce)

Instructions

  • Add all of the ingredients to a blender and blend until well combined. Serve right away or transfer to the refrigerator to chill.

Nutrition

Calories: 141kcal | Carbohydrates: 2g | Protein: 1g | Fat: 14g | Saturated Fat: 2g | Cholesterol: 9mg | Sodium: 358mg | Potassium: 25mg | Fiber: 1g | Sugar: 1g | Vitamin A: 154IU | Calcium: 21mg | Iron: 1mg
